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team arrives quickly at your home to assess the situation, taking note of the extent of the damage, water source, and affected areas. We’ll create a customized plan to ensure all affected materials are properly removed, and equipment is deployed efficiently to reduce downtime.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
Our technicians use industrial-grade pumps and extractors to remove standing water quickly and effectively. We’ll also use wet vacuums and towels to soak up excess moisture, reducing the risk of water dam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
To prevent further damage, our team uses advanced drying equipment to dry the affected are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also dehumidify the space to prevent moisture from seeping back into the area.
Step 4: Inspection and Clean-up
After the water removal process is complete, our team thoroughly inspects your property to identify any hidden water damage or potential issues. We’ll also clean and disinfect the affected areas to prevent bacterial growth and odors.

Warning Signs You Need Laundry Room Water Removal in Combine, TX
Catching water damage early on can save you a significant amount of money and prevent more severe problems from occurring. Be aware of these warning signs to avoid delays and complications: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your laundry room, it’s likely a sign of hidden water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ore this warning sign, address it qu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Visible water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ors show water damage. Take action quickly to prevent mold growth and structural dam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it’s likely a sign of excessive moisture.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Excessive Moisture or Humidity
If your laundry room feels excessively humid or damp, it can lead to mold growth and structural damage. Take action quickly to prevent further complications.
Visible Mold or Mildew
Visible mold or mildew growth is a clear warning sign of water damage or excessive moisture. Don’t ignore this issue, address it qu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Laundry Room Water Removal Cost in Combine, TX
The cost of laundry room water removal var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Combine, TX.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more for extensive water removal and restoration services.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500-$1,500 | Size of affected area and number of pumps needed.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$300-$1,000 | Size of affected area, type of drying equipment used. |
| Inspection and clean-up | $100-$500 | Complexity of the job and materials required. |
| Pump rental and equipment costs | $200-$1,000 | Type of equipment used and rental duration. |
